webviewjavascriptbridge android 调用js方法失败
问题
项目需要引进了webviewjavascriptbridge
, 在ios和android两个平台使用, 在js端注册了方法
bridge.registerHandler('testJavascriptHandler', function(data, responseCallback) {
alert(data); // 测试效果
var responseData = { 'Javascript Says':'Right back atcha!' };
responseCallback(responseData);
});
结果是ios调用ok, 正常alert; android死活调用不了. 但是但是, js去调用android的方法却可以, 并且用webviewjavascriptbridge的github库里的示例example.html来测试两个平台都ok.
我就纳闷了...为啥ios可以调用js的方法android却不可以. 初始化应该是没问题的, 不然js调用android的方法也会失败.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(3)
能提供下安卓的下载地址吗
兄弟解决了吗?
问题姐解决了吗?